The current transition toward sustainable solutions is driven by a sophisticated understanding of material science. Research indicates that the shift away from traditional single-use plastics is not merely a temporary trend but a fundamental restructuring of the entire supply chain. Industry experts suggest that the integration of compostable films and recyclable paperboards is becoming the baseline for all new product launches moving forward. These materials are now engineered to provide the same barrier properties as their predecessors, effectively protecting moisture levels and preventing oxidation. These technical factors are crucial for maintaining the sensory qualities—such as the crispness of a crust or the softness of a crumb—in artisanal breads and delicate cakes alike.
Market analysts observe that the move toward "right-sized" packaging is another significant development gaining momentum. By optimizing the dimensions of containers to fit specific products, companies are effectively reducing material waste and streamlining logistics. This precision-based approach reflects a broader commitment to efficiency that resonates with modern environmental values. Furthermore, the use of water-based inks and biodegradable coatings is replacing traditional chemical-heavy alternatives. This ensures that every element of the package can be safely returned to the environment or repurposed within a circular economy, reducing the pressure on waste management systems globally.

Beyond the materials themselves, operational strategies within the baking sector are also evolving to accommodate these new substrates. High-speed production lines are being recalibrated to handle thinner, more flexible sustainable films without compromising output efficiency. Industry observers note that while the initial transition required investment in machinery and training, the long-term benefits include enhanced brand loyalty and compliance with increasingly stringent global standards for waste reduction. The logistical advantages of modern, sustainable packaging are also becoming more apparent. Newer bio-based materials are being developed to be lighter than traditional glass or heavy-duty plastics, which significantly reduces the carbon footprint associated with transportation. For large-scale bakery operations that distribute products across regions, these incremental savings in weight lead to substantial reductions in fuel consumption and shipping costs.
